Enjoy an unforgettable experience at the Fairmont RJ Copacabana, located in one of the most spectacular places in Rio de Janeiro, the Copacabana Beach, under the majestic gaze of Sugar Loaf Mountain. Inspired by the glamour carioca in the 1950's, this luxury hotel is an oasis. There are 10 rooms categories with a balcony, and the Gold Rooms offer a private lounge and exclusive services.

This is one of those hotels that has a very impressive lobby, credentials, and the supposed 5 stars but the actual experience does not live up to the hype or the price at all. First of all, front desk is just unresponsive. We arrived late at 2am from a long flight and were super hungry. They assured us at check-in that they have 24/7 room service. Well, once we got to the room, I called (multiple times) room service, front desk, concierge, etc - no one replied. Went to sleep hungry. Second, literally everything in this hotel is broken. In our first room, balcony door didn’t lock at all, so we heard all the street noises the whole night. Shower handle was also broken. There was hair in the shower. There was tons of mold. We asked for a new room, so they offered another one - that one also had the balcony door broken (this time it wouldn’t open). In our third room, bathroom door didn’t lock, chromecast didn’t work, and some shower tubes were broken. I told them about the bathroom door, they said they’ll send someone up to fix it - never happened. Whenever I tried to call front desk even during normal hours - no response at all. Might as well not have the phone in the room. Asked to use the hotel ATM (so I can leave some tips) - surprise, hotel ATM is broken. Btw, they include 10-15% service fee on your hotel bill for everything so maybe don’t tip. But they don’t tell you that until the end. Service was spotty. Almost no one speaks any English, so anytime you order at the pool or restaurant, they get stuff wrong. I’m happy to explain or use Google Translate but they just assure you they understood and then bring something else. We had friends who stayed in a different hotel come visit us for a drink by the pool - that turned out to be a huge issue and they gave us a bunch of trouble for it without trying to accommodate us. I tried to provide this feedback to the hotel directly but they either ignored me or just never picked up the phone. When I checked out, they didn’t care to ask how things were. So I’m writing up here instead as a warning for others. Don’t expect a 5 star experience and expect things to be broken, service to be spotty and unresponsive.
